diff --git a/packages/nuxt3/src/nuxt.ts b/packages/nuxt3/src/nuxt.ts index 0031c264a0..2db83ec8e5 100644 --- a/packages/nuxt3/src/nuxt.ts +++ b/packages/nuxt3/src/nuxt.ts @@ -54,7 +54,6 @@ export async function loadNuxt (opts: LoadNuxtOptions): Promise { const { appDir } = await import('@nuxt/app/meta') options.appDir = appDir options._majorVersion = 3 - options.alias.vue = normalize(require.resolve('vue/dist/vue.esm-bundler.js')) options.buildModules.push(normalize(require.resolve('@nuxt/pages/module'))) options.buildModules.push(normalize(require.resolve('@nuxt/meta/module'))) options.buildModules.push(normalize(require.resolve('@nuxt/component-discovery/module'))) diff --git a/packages/vite/src/vite.ts b/packages/vite/src/vite.ts index 1bd043a919..37a9ad512c 100644 --- a/packages/vite/src/vite.ts +++ b/packages/vite/src/vite.ts @@ -49,9 +49,7 @@ export async function bundle (nuxt: Nuxt) { vue: {}, css: {}, optimizeDeps: { - exclude: [ - 'vue-router' - ] + exclude: [] }, esbuild: { jsxFactory: 'h',